Abstract
The utility model discloses a kind of unmanned marine propeller protective devices, belong to unmanned boat technical field.It includes the cover side plate, the cover side plate is fixedly mounted on unmanned floor, and propeller is located at the inside of the cover side plate, the cover side plate and the unmanned floor limit water inlet, water outlet and aquaporin, and the water inlet and the water outlet are mounted on water flowing component.The utility model solves the problems, such as that the propulsive force generated in current marine propeller rotary course is relatively dispersed, it not only overcomes because the propeller sucking sundries such as water plant fishing net cause unmanned boat can not work normally and when propeller exposed rotation hurts sb.'s feelings or the defect of fish, unmanned boat is also improved in the stability of the water surface, is not likely to produce to jolt and rock.

Background technique
With the development and application of unmanned boat technology, unmanned boat is recognized by more and more people, the application range of unmanned boat
It is increasingly wider.More and more using unmanned boat, the power resources of unmanned boat directly connect with water when propeller, propeller works
It touches, in rotary course, blade is constantly backward pushed a large amount of propulsive mediums, a forward power is generated on the concave surface of blade, i.e.,
Propulsive force, the propulsive force are greater than the resistance on blade convex surface, steamer can be pushed to be carried forward.But during this, propeller holds
Vulnerable to aquatic organism or the collision of other objects, winding, this will affect the normal work of propeller, or even will cause propeller damage
It is bad, and can also hurt the biologies such as the people of water went swimming or the fish of preciousness.Therefore, to propeller carry out protection be must can not
Few.
Chinese invention patent, publication number: CN102180252A, publication date: it is anti-to disclose propeller on September 14th, 2011
The effect of winding, including hull and propeller, the propeller periphery on hull are equipped with antiwind shield, and there are many wear the shield
Saturating through-hole, and be fixed on hull;Reach the spiral shell for preventing the sundries such as fishing net to be wrapped in propeller outer end by antiwind shield
Propeller is protected on rotation paddle, is prevented because of people and biological injures and deaths and because being twined by class fishing net object in water caused by when hull propeller works
Around and the ineffective generation for causing peril.The disadvantages are as follows: the antiwind shield that (1) is arranged according to the technical solution
Easily the fltting speed of ship is caused to hinder;(2) stability is poor when ship is advanced in water, easily jolts and rocks in the water surface.

3, beneficial effect
Compared with the prior art, the utility model has the following beneficial effects:
(1) the utility model limits aquaporin by the cover side plate, and water flow only passes through water outlet in propeller rotary course
Discharge is discharged without dissipating to side, thus propeller can to greatest extent with water phase interaction and generate biggish push away
Power, to solve existing Propeller Guard cover since surrounding has the mesh of water flowing, water is easy in propeller rotary course
Diverging is discharged and has dispersed propulsive force around, and then forms the problem of hindering to the advance of ship, has the advantages that efficiency is high;
(2) the utility model is by the installed protection device outside propeller, help avoid propeller and aquatic organism or
The collision of other objects of person, winding, guarantee the normal work of propeller, while will not damage to aquatic organism, have peace
The high feature of full performance;
(3) the utility model is by filter screen or grid and cellular board to the water flow entered in protective device aquaporin
Filtering is formed, the sundries in water is avoided to be sucked into protective device and generate damage to propeller;
(4) water outlet of the utility model is shunk relative to water inlet, so that the effective cross section product of water outlet is less than
The effective cross section product of water inlet, thus the speed of water flow outlet is helped to improve, and then mention at reaction thrust to propeller shape
Rise the fltting speed of unmanned boat;
(5) the cover side plate is arranged to arc panel by the utility model, helps to reduce resistance;
(6) spoiler on the outside of the utility model the cover side plate can effectively buffer influence of the water level fluctuation to unmanned boat,
Unmanned boat is improved in the stability of the water surface, is not likely to produce to jolt and rock;
(7) cellular board of the utility model is removably connect with the cover side plate, convenient for component installation, disassembly and
Cleaning and the maintenance of propeller are carried out to protective device inside;
(8) being realized by way of protrusion and groove cooperation for the utility model is detachably connected, and passes through screw rod, peace
The advantages of mode being threadedly coupled is realized with unmanned floor in dress hole, has structure simple, easily designed manufacture.

Specific embodiment
The utility model is further described below in the following with reference to the drawings and specific embodiments.
Embodiment 1
As shown in Figure 1 to Figure 3, a kind of unmanned marine propeller protective device, including the cover side plate 5, the cover side plate 5
It is fixedly mounted on unmanned floor, and propeller is located at the inside of the cover side plate 5, the cover side plate 5 and the nothing
People's floor limits water inlet, water outlet and aquaporin, and the water inlet and the water outlet are mounted on water flowing portion
Part.
The water sucked from water inlet is pushed into water outlet by propeller rotation, since the cover side plate 5 and unmanned floor limit
Aquaporin, water flow carry out flow direction integration in aquaporin, and are only capable of being discharged by water outlet, guarantee the direction of water flow discharge
The direction for the reaction force that will not be dissipated, thus generate is also more consistent;And Propeller Guard cover is due to surrounding in the prior art
There is the mesh of water flowing, easily diverging is discharged and has dispersed propulsive force water around in propeller rotary course, and then to ship
Advance and form the problem of hindering, therefore, the propeller protective device of the present embodiment has high excellent of efficiency compared with the existing technology
Point.In addition, helping avoid propeller by the installed protection device outside propeller and being touched with aquatic organism or other objects
It hits, wind, guarantee the normal work of propeller, while will not damage to aquatic organism, with the high spy of security performance
Point.
Embodiment 2
As shown in Figures 1 to 4, a kind of unmanned marine propeller protective device, structure are different compared to the examples,
Be: the water inlet and the water outlet are mounted on filter screen.
In specific application, can also be by the way of following: the i.e. described water flowing component includes grid 1 and cellular board 2, institute
The setting of grid 1 is stated in the water inlet, the cellular board 2 is arranged in the water outlet.
Filtering is formed by the water flow that filter screen or 2 pairs of grid 1 and cellular board enter in protective device aquaporin, is kept away
Exempt from the sundries in water to be sucked into protective device and generate damage to propeller
Embodiment 3
As shown in Figures 1 to 4, a kind of unmanned marine propeller protective device, structure are different compared to the examples,
Be: the water outlet is shunk relative to the water inlet, and water outlet is shunk relative to water inlet, so that effective cross of water outlet
Sectional area be less than water inlet effective cross section product, water flow by water outlet be discharged when speed relative to water flow pass through water inlet into
The speed entered is higher, i.e., this structure helps to improve the speed of water flow outlet, and then mentions to propeller shape at reaction thrust
Rise the fltting speed of unmanned boat.
Embodiment 4
As shown in Figure 1 to Figure 3, a kind of unmanned marine propeller protective device, structure are different compared to the examples,
Be: the cover side plate 5 is arc panel, and arc panel has the curved surface of rounding off, helps to reduce resistance.
Embodiment 5
As shown in Figures 1 to 4, a kind of unmanned marine propeller protective device, structure are different compared to the examples,
Be: the outside of the cover side plate 5 is provided with spoiler 4, and the spoiler 4 includes the vertical plate of multiple alternate settings, this reality
The influence that the spoiler 4 in example can effectively buffer water level fluctuation to unmanned boat is applied, improves unmanned boat in the stability of the water surface,
It is not likely to produce to jolt and rock.
Embodiment 6
As shown in Figures 1 to 4, a kind of unmanned marine propeller protective device, structure are different compared to the examples,
Be: the cellular board 2 is removably connect with the cover side plate 5, and cellular board 2 is removably connect with the cover side plate 5, is convenient for
To the installation of component, disassembly and cleaning and the maintenance of propeller are carried out to protective device inside.
In specific application, the specific structure being detachably connected can use following form: the periphery of the cellular board 2
It is provided with protrusion 7, is arranged fluted 6, described raised 7 on the cover side plate 5 and is matched with the groove 6, this form tool
There is the advantages of structure is simple, easily designed manufacture.
Embodiment 7
As shown in Figure 1 to Figure 3, a kind of unmanned marine propeller protective device, structure are different compared to the examples,
Be: further including screw rod, mounting hole 3 is provided on the cover side plate 5, and the screw rod is located in the mounting hole 3, and with it is described
The connection of unmanned boat base thread has structure letter in such a way that screw rod, mounting hole 3 are threadedly coupled with the realization of unmanned floor
The advantages of list, easily designed manufacture, convenient for worker's installation, disassembly and maintenance and is replaced.
